Deepika Breaks Down While Talking About Chhapaak, Vikrant Massey Says, “I’m Thick Skinned”

The makers have released the trailer of Deepika Padukone and Vikrant Massey starrer Chhapaak. Deepika is seen portraying the role of Malti inspired by acid attack survivor Laxmi Aggarwal in the film.

The moving trailer of the film showcases how Malti’s life changes after the acid attack and all that she goes through, right from medical treatment to societal pressure and her fight against the crime.

When asked about the film during the trailer launch, Deepika told India Today, “Maine sirf iss moment ke baare main socha tha ki aap log trailer dekhenge aur fir humein stage main aana hai. Uske baad humein kuch bolna hai iske baare main toh maine socha nahi tha”

(I thought that we will be called upon the stage after you watch the trailer. I didn’t know that I will have to speak after that),” and then she broke down.

She asked director Meghna Gulzar to “carry on”. Gulzar and co-star Vikrant Massey consoled the Padmaavat star. Deepika has earlier shared how moved she was to play the role of an acid attack survivor in the film. She has also burnt the prosthetics used in the film to get rid of the depressive thoughts she had after shooting.

When asked if the film has affected Massey on the same scale, he told IE, “I am very thick-skinned, so I didn’t break down on sets. I have taken a lot back with me from this film. These learnings and experiences will stay with me for a very long time.”

“This film is important for various reasons. It is important to tell this story today, given the situation of women in our country. I have got the opportunity to work with a fine director and co-star,” he added.

Later on, while talking about the film Deepika said, “It’s not often when you come across a story where you have to sit through an entire narration. Usually, you have to sit through the entire process and then decide whether you want to do a film or not. It’s not often when you come across a story where you know instantly in the first few minutes of meeting a director that this is it. We have made the film with a lot of love, a lot of passion, a lot of enthusiasm and a lot of responsibility.”

Massey spoke in detail about his character in the film, “I am Amol in the film. The character is based on Alok Dixit, who was with Laxmi in her journey. With the kind of stories we read in newspapers, with the crimes against women, I think it was time that we tell a story like this as responsibly as possible through cinema,” he said.

Chhapaak is Deepika and Massey’s very first collaboration. He will be seen portraying the role of Deepika’s love interest in the film. The film is set to hit the silver screen on January 10, 2020.
